Eoin Fairgrieve is a World Team Speycasting Champion and widely regarded as one of the world's leading speycasting instructors. At the age of 24, Eoin became one of the youngest ever instructors to qualify in both the AAPGAI trout and salmon disciplines and has been professionally teaching fly casting and fly fishing for almost twenty years.
Eoin began working as a salmon guide on the famous Makerstoun beat of the River Tweed in 1988, before starting up his teaching practice in 2001 to concentrate on casting instruction and education on the Tweed system.
He specialises mainly in teaching modern speycasting techniques in a relaxed and friendly environment at his Centre of Excellence located in the Scottish Borders.
All fly casting instruction will take place at Eoin Fairgrieve's teaching centre based at the Roxburghe Lake and the Sunlaws beat of the River Teviot. The client or clients are asked to arrive at least 15 minutes before the lesson is scheduled to start to allow short transit time to either the river or the lake. Each session will be two hours in duration with the morning sessions from 10am to 12pm and the afternoon sessions from 2pm to 4pm. If the client/clients request additional instruction at the end of the session, this will be charged on an hourly basis at £40 per hour. The client/clients are expected to supply their own waders and outdoor clothing, but all safety equipment and appropriate tackle can be provided by the teaching centre. All clients must wear clear safety glasses or suitable sunglasses as eye protection during the instruction period.
